Bio

A novelist, artist, and cartoonist from England is named Ralph Steadman. When he first joined an advertising firm early in his life, his passion for cartooning and sketching was kindled. He made it a point to study the craft at several different British institutions, including the School of Printing and Graphic Arts, East Ham Technical College, and Percy V. Bradshaw’s correspondence school.

For many years, Steadman provided his political, satirical, and darkly humorous drawings to newspapers in England and America such as Kemsley Newspaper Group, Daily Mail, New York Times, etc. His collaborations with American writer Hunter S. Thompson, which include “Fear and Loathing in Las Vegas,” “Fear and Loathing on the Campaign Trail ’72,” “Kentucky Derby” for Scanlan, etc., are widely regarded as his most well-known works. Since of his direct approach to politics and political people, his cartoons were seen as subversive and gloomy.

However, by the early 1980s, he had begun to lose interest in political cartooning because he believed that there was little substance left in global politics. He started producing his own illustrated books and published several works of art, including “Alice in Wonderland,” “I Leonard,” “Doodaa,” etc. He has received honors such as the Certificate of Merit from the American Society of Illustrators, the W H Smith Illustration Award, the BBC Design Award, etc. Lionel Raphael Steadman, a business traveler who sold women’s apparel, was the father of Ralph Steadman, who was born in Wallasey, Cheshire, into a lower-middle-class family. His mother worked as a store clerk.

When Steadman reached the age of 16, he left Abergele Grammar School because he could not stand the overbearing power his headmaster imposed on him. He started working for the aviation firm De Havilland. Steadman joined Woolworths as a trainee manager after quickly becoming weary of the factory lifestyle. He was engaged in 1954 by McConnell’s Advertising Agency in Colwyn Bay.

During his National Service in the RAF in Britain from 1954 to 1956, Steadman also continued to enroll in Percy V. Bradshaw’s cartooning correspondence course since at this point his passion for illustration had developed. His parents paid for the course. Ralph was asked to create the wine catalogs for the wine retailer Oddbins in the 1980s. Many of his own publications, like “Sigmund Freud,” “The Big I Am about God,” “Doodaa,” etc., were written and drawn by him.

In 1989, Steadman and composer Richard Harvey co-wrote “The Plague and the Moonflower,” an oratorio for an eco-opera. Through the metaphorical love affair between the moonflower and the plague monster, it examines environmental degradation. In 1990, Ralph was asked to create a new ballet based on Arthur Miller’s “The Crucible” for the Royal Opera House. Steadman himself had poured, flung, and smeared greasy paints all over the garments.

Charlie Paul’s documentary “For No Good Reason,” on Steadman’s career, had its world premiere at the 2013 Toronto International Film Festival. The movie took 15 years to create. He began sketching in 1955 and made weekly submissions to “Punch,” but it wasn’t until the following year that his first cartoon was printed in the Manchester Evening Chronicle. The topic of the cartoon was “Nasser and the Suez crisis.”

Steadman began working as a cartoonist at the Kemsley Newspaper Group in 1959. Editorial cartoons and a weekly panel featuring the imaginary adolescent female character “Teeny” were contributions he made to the publication. 8 He also took part-time painting classes from Leslie Richardson at East Ham Technical College at the same time. He used to report to work at Kemsley at ten in the morning and leave by three in the afternoon to go to college.

Steadman began working for himself after being let go from Kemsley and supplied his cartoons to Punch, the Daily Sketch, and the Daily Telegraph. Steadman sent a sketch titled “Plastic People” to Private Eye, and the editor of the magazine sent him five pounds with the comment, “More power to your elbow.” It was printed as a two-page spread in the journal.

On Leslie Richardson’s advice, he attended the London School of Printing and Graphic Arts from 1961 to 1965. He was underperforming commercially and was eclipsed by his former buddy and rival Gerry Scarfe, which contributed to his decline. After completing his education, Steadman was employed by Daily Mail in 1966 and given a sizable salary along with an E-type Jaguar. He was appointed artist-in-residence at Sussex University the following year.

He briefly worked for Rolling Stone in 1970 before being employed by the radical American publication Scanlan’s Monthly. The book “Fear and Loathing in Las Vegas” by Hunter S. Thompson was illustrated by Steadman the following year. By the end of 1970, Steadman had returned to London and was working as The Times’ second political cartoonist, covering the General Election.

Steadman produced political cartoons for the New Statesman between 1976 and 1980. His drawings started to take on a more primitive character. He worked at the National Theatre during this period and also provided writing for magazines like Rolling Stone and the New York Times, among others. Together, Ralph and Bernard Stone wrote children’s books, including the iconic Inspector Mouse and Emergency Mouse. Finally, Quasimodo Mouse was included in the triptic.
